]> git.ipfire.org Git - thirdparty/systemd.git/commitdiff
Enable systemd-coredump for offline updates
authorAdam Williamson <awilliam@redhat.com>
Mon, 17 Nov 2025 22:35:11 +0000 (14:35 -0800)
committerYu Watanabe <watanabe.yu+github@gmail.com>
Fri, 2 Jan 2026 00:31:20 +0000 (09:31 +0900)
If a crash occurs during an offline update, we do not get a
coredump, because systemd-coredump is not enabled. This of course
complicates debugging.

Signed-off-by: Adam Williamson <awilliam@redhat.com>
units/meson.build

index 2e04c4aa2b2c88f18198231608c0ae596fb53620..ddaefc56e8cc5150fc73b230c7faa1f7295c6508 100644 (file)
@@ -310,7 +310,7 @@ units = [
         {
           'file' : 'systemd-coredump.socket',
           'conditions' : ['ENABLE_COREDUMP'],
-          'symlinks' : ['sockets.target.wants/'],
+          'symlinks' : ['sockets.target.wants/', 'system-update-pre.target.wants/'],
         },
         {
           'file' : 'systemd-coredump@.service.in',